Indraprastha Gas ROIC % Calculation

Indraprastha Gas's annualized Return on Invested Capital (ROIC %) for the fiscal year that ended in Mar. 2024 is calculated as:

ROIC % (A: Mar. 2024 )
=NOPAT/Average Invested Capital
=Operating Income * ( 1 - Tax Rate % )/( (Invested Capital (A: Mar. 2023 ) + Invested Capital (A: Mar. 2024 ))/ count )
=19497 * ( 1 - 21.99% )/( (102384.4 + 129344.7)/ 2 )
=15209.6097/115864.55
=13.13 %

where

Invested Capital(A: Mar. 2023 )
=Total Assets - Accounts Payable & Accrued Expense - Excess Cash
=Total Assets - Accounts Payable & Accrued Expense - (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ities - max(0, Total Current Liabilities - Total Current Assets+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ities))
=126206 - 23858.4 - ( 23308.2 - max(0, 42315.8 - 42279+23308.2))
=102384.4

Invested Capital(A: Mar. 2024 )
=Total Assets - Accounts Payable & Accrued Expense - Excess Cash
=Total Assets - Accounts Payable & Accrued Expense - (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ities - max(0, Total Current Liabilities - Total Current Assets+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ities))
=142199.6 - 10020.7 - ( 32473.5 - max(0, 40800.2 - 43634.4+32473.5))
=129344.7

Indraprastha Gas's annualized Return on Invested Capital (ROIC %) for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2024 is calculated as:

ROIC % (Q: Mar. 2024 )
=NOPAT/Average Invested Capital
=Operating Income * ( 1 - Tax Rate % )/( (Invested Capital (Q: Dec. 2023 ) + Invested Capital (Q: Mar. 2024 ))/ count )
=15644.8 * ( 1 - 23.87% )/( (0 + 129344.7)/ 1 )
=11910.38624/129344.7
=9.21 %

where

Invested Capital(Q: Mar. 2024 )
=Total Assets - Accounts Payable & Accrued Expense - Excess Cash
=Total Assets - Accounts Payable & Accrued Expense - (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ities - max(0, Total Current Liabilities - Total Current Assets+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ities))
=142199.6 - 10020.7 - ( 32473.5 - max(0, 40800.2 - 43634.4+32473.5))
=129344.7

Note: The Operating Income data used here is four times the quarterly (Mar. 2024) data.

Indraprastha Gas  (BOM:532514) ROIC % Explanation

ROIC % measures how well a company generates cash flow relative to the capital it has invested in its business. It is also called ROC %. The reason book values of debt and equity are used is because the book values are the capital the company received when issuing the debt or receiving the equity investments.

There are four key components to this definition. The first is the use of operating income or EBIT rather than net income in the numerator. The second is the tax adjustment to this operating income or EBIT, computed as a hypothetical tax based on an effective or marginal tax rate. The third is the use of book values for invested capital, rather than market values. The final is the timing difference; the capital invested is from the end of the prior year whereas the operating income or EBIT is the current year's number.

Why is ROIC % important?

Because it costs money to raise capital. A firm that generates higher returns on investment than it costs the company to raise the capital needed for that investment is earning excess returns. A firm that expects to continue generating positive excess returns on new investments in the future will see its value increase as growth increases, whereas a firm that earns returns that do not match up to its cost of capital will destroy value as it grows.

Be Aware

Like ROE % and ROA %, ROIC % is calculated with only 12 months of data. Fluctuations in the company's earnings or business cycles can affect the ratio drastically. It is important to look at the ratio from a long term perspective.

Indraprastha Gas Ltd, or IGL, is an Indian utility company that derives nearly all of its revenue from the sale of natural gas. IGL supplies compressed natural gas (CNG) to the transport sector and piped natural gas (PNG) to domestic, industrial, and commercial sector customers. Most of the natural gas sold by IGL is in the form of compressed natural gas. CNG is an alternative to fossil fuels that is distributed from IGL's portfolio of fueling stations to power a variety of vehicles. The vast majority of these CNG stations are located in the Delhi and National Capital Regions. IGL distributes a significant amount of natural gas through its network of pipelines in Delhi and the National Capital Region, as well. The customers served by IGL's PNG business are primarily residential consumers.
